About this card

HP: 60Type:PPsychicSubtype: BasicEvolves to: Tentacruel

"It drifts through the sea searching for prey. Its poisonous tentacles break off sometimes, but after a while, they grow back."

CWrap — 10

Flip a coin. If heads, your opponent's Active Pokémon is now Paralyzed.

Weakness:P×2

Retreat cost:C

How can I tell if my Tentacool is real?

Tentacool is not on our list of commonly-counterfeited cards, but counterfeits exist across every set. Check the back-light test (real cards have a black inner layer that blocks light; counterfeits glow through), the rosette dot pattern on the back under magnification, font weight and kerning on the card name, and the holofoil pattern if applicable. For high-value copies we recommend submitting to a professional grader (PSA, BGS, CGC) for tamper-evident authentication.
